RLC Sledding & Snow Rules

Clothing

  • You need to wear snow pants, a winter coat, gloves/mitts, toque, and boots when sledding

  • Inside shoes need to be brought if not already – wet footwear comes off at the door and brush off snow from your body

Going Down the Hill – only sledding hill is the hill in Zone 4

  • Line up

  • Slide on your bum only, feet first – NO HEAD FIRST EVER

  • Look before you slide

  • No more than 1 person per sled – NO linking or making of chains

  • Clear the bottom of the hill quickly

  • Slide between the cones

  • No jumps will be built – NO launching or running starts

Going Up the Hill

  • Walk up outside the coned area

When / Where you may slide

  • When your cohort is assigned to Zone 4 (no sledding outside the hill area of Zone 4)

  • When the bell rings, sliding ends immediately!

Sleds

  • Crazy carpets and soft-sided flat foam sleds only, no GTs

  • If you bring your own sled you must have it clearly labelled with your name

  • You may not take anyone else’s sled

  • Sleds must be left outside the door you line up at to come inside

  • The school cannot supply sleds at this time

Safety

  • The hill will be closed when it is icy

Rules will be followed, or you will lose the sledding hill: individually, by group or whole school – Teachers and

  • supervisors will decide – do not argue with them if you are told to leave the area

  • Snow STAYS on the ground! NO SNOWBALLS!

  • Be kind

  • Do not destroy someone else’s snowman

  • Do not build snowmen at the bottom of the sledding hills
